WebSep 26, 2024 · How to Add Python to PATH on Windows The first step is to locate the directory in which your target Python executable lives. The path to the directory is what you’ll be adding to the PATH environment variable. To find the Python executable, you’ll need to look for a file called python.exe. WebDjango defines a standard API for loading and rendering templates regardless of the backend. Loading consists of finding the template for a given identifier and preprocessing it, usually compiling it to an in-memory representation. Rendering means interpolating the template with context data and returning the resulting string.
